FIRST REPORT: A Bachur walking on Ocean Avenue early this morning was assaulted and robbed, TLS has learned. The Bachur, 20, was walking in the Clover Street area approximately 1:00 a.m. when he was approached by two black males and one black female, according to Lakewood Police Detective Lieutenant William Addison. The Bachur was punched and knocked to the ground by one of the males, while the other male pinned him to the ground and proceeded to rob him, Addison said. The three then fled and left the Bachur lying on the ground, with a broken jaw.
The Bachur then got up and managed to walk over to Police Headquarters where he reported the incident.
Police immediately dispatched K-9 Units to the scene of the attack, where they were able to trace a scent.
After some time, one black male, the one who pinned down the Bachur, exited a home in the area, and was identified by the victim.
He was subsequently arrested and taken into Police custody. Bail was set at $20,000 for the attacker.
The other two have not yet been identified.
